4·1 day agoYoure going to have to look at a spec sheet, but the stoves with a built-in battery tend to designed to draw a constant low amperage as they charge, and then be able to cook about three meals from the battery. Very different from stoves without a battery.

8·1 day agoThere are a few models of induction stove which include a large battery to run them by charging from 120v. Stoves are also kind of unique in that they have far less effective venting of exhaust than other appliances, so the health risk from them is much larger.
If youre able to get enough sunlight to charge the stove, its worth thinking about.

71·3 days agoCongress can remove a justice with a majority vote in the house and a 2/3 supermajority in the Senate. This means you can’t actually remove a judge unless they lose support from within their own party, and the Republicans have shown that they wont go along with removal no matter what.
This means that in practice, the path forward is to add additional judges, so that the Republicans are a minority, and unable to do any damage.

2·7 days agoThey’re apparently allowed to create an “administrative” warrant which doesn’t get signed by a judge and which people don’t need to honor by opening their door. But almost nobody knows the difference between that and a judicial warrant, so they abuse them to the max.
